python
小孙不够睡
IT小学生,随便写写,分享技术
个人博客:https://stephen-smj.tech/
展开
-
Python与Conda创建虚拟环境
Python和conda创建虚拟环境,与区别原创 2023-10-07 20:38:21 · 419 阅读 · 0 评论 -
博客图片被设置防盗链接?别慌,我爆肝三晚写了这个批量图片站点转移脚本(已开源)
csdn防盗链接导致无法显示图片,此脚本可批量转移站点原创 2023-03-21 22:11:31 · 450 阅读 · 0 评论 -
浅拷贝和深拷贝的区别
深拷贝和浅拷贝的区别原创 2023-03-09 19:44:55 · 811 阅读 · 0 评论 -
【JAVA循环和Python循环的区别】
JAVA for循环中修改i值会影响循环过程,Python for循环中修改i值不会影响循环过程。原创 2023-02-22 13:14:47 · 455 阅读 · 0 评论 -
Flask获取请求的几种方式
本文介绍了python发送请求以及flask接受请求数据的几种方式原创 2022-11-01 18:02:21 · 1071 阅读 · 0 评论 -
网格搜索GridSearchCV中的坑
我们常用的调参函数GridSearchCV有一个叫greater_is_better的属性,默认为True,这个属性是什么意思呢,就是评分越大的参数是越好的,听上去好像没什么问题,但是有些评分策略是评分越小越好,比如我们常用的MSE,当你在使用MSE来评分时,如果选择了greater_is_better=True,那么就会选择MSE分数高的参数,也就是选择了不好的参数,跟我们想要的结果恰恰相反。如果是R2,Accuracy这种分数越高越好的评分策略那选True当然没问题啦。真的是深坑啊!!现在才知道有这个.原创 2021-10-01 18:10:41 · 1046 阅读 · 0 评论 -
pytorch tensor类型转换中的深坑
pytorch tensor类型转换中的深坑今天在写代码时遇到了一个奇怪的问题,当我定义一个全部为整型的tensor变量,我发现其中的元素会自动转换成浮点型:找了很久原因才发现是方法名有着极微的差别:torch.Tensor()是用来定义浮点型tensor类型的,也就是说不管你里面元素填的什么类型,最终都会变成浮点型而torch.tensor() 注意是小写t,才是用来定义tensor类型变量的,你里面写什么类型的元素他就是什么类型的另外记录一下tensor的类型转化方法:dtype=tro原创 2021-08-12 18:41:12 · 395 阅读 · 0 评论 -
python算法:已知线性拟合的两条直线求其交点
什么?两直线求交点?这不是初中数学吗??还需要专门写一个算法?我第一看到这个问题也是这样想的,觉得简直不要太简单,相信如果是在试卷上用笔算一定是半分钟解决的问题,可就是这简简单单的初中题目想要呈现在程序中却足足花了我两个小时。我第一次遇到这个问题是在做线性拟合模型的时候,两条线性模型交汇于一点,只要求出交点就可以精确的求出影响转折点:(我觉得可能这个算法的应用都在这个领域吧)python中还没有能直接表示一条线的类型,因此我们要表示一条直线,应该用什么方法呢?我首先想到的是用两点,因为两点确定一条直原创 2020-11-26 23:36:05 · 2186 阅读 · 7 评论 -
python爬虫爬取豆瓣电影评分排行榜前n名的前n页影评
目标网站https://movie.douban.com/explore#!type=movie&tag=%E8%B1%86%E7%93%A3%E9%AB%98%E5%88%86&sort=rank&page_limit=20&page_start=0(豆瓣电影——选电影——豆瓣高分——按评价排序)爬虫基本思路1.首先发送请求并返回requests(最好模拟谷歌浏览器的头部访问(即下面的headers),并且设置一个每次访问的间隔时间,这样就不容易触发网站的反爬机制(原创 2020-11-21 15:58:39 · 2708 阅读 · 0 评论 -
python爬虫爬取桌面壁纸
目标美图网站:http://www.weather.com.cn/weather/101210701.shtml(有彩蛋)爬虫的基本思路:1.首先发送请求并返回requests(最好模拟谷歌浏览器的头部访问(即下面的headers),并且设置一个每次访问的间隔时间,这样就不容易触发网站的反爬机制(说白了就是模拟人类的访问行为))2.获得requests对象后使用BeautifulSoup (美丽的汤??也不知道为啥要起这个名)来解析requests对象,注意这里要用request.text,就取文本原创 2020-11-21 15:32:05 · 661 阅读 · 0 评论 -
python爬虫爬取天气预报信息
目标天气预报网站:http://www.weather.com.cn/weather/101210701.shtml需要用到的库有requests(用来发送请求和接收url)BeautifulSoup(用来解析html文本)爬虫的基本思路:1.首先发送请求并返回requests(最好模拟谷歌浏览器的头部访问(即下面的headers),并且设置一个每次访问的间隔时间,这样就不容易触发网站的反爬机制(说白了就是模拟人类的访问行为))2.获得requests对象后使用BeautifulSoup (美丽的汤原创 2020-11-21 15:25:23 · 5772 阅读 · 3 评论 -
Python matplotlib绘图保存图片空白问题
今天在写python用matplotlib绘制折线图的时候遇到了一个问题:用plt.savefig(’./tmp/first.jpg’)保存图片后打开发现是空白的一张图片:但是jupyter notebook里面运行显示是正常的原因:先写了 plt.show()再写plt.savefig()在使用plt.show()的时候会生成一张新的空白的画布。这时候再使用plt.savefig()就会导致保存下来的图片是刚才plt.show()生成的新的画布,所以是空白的。解决方法:只需要先写plt.原创 2020-10-28 15:46:05 · 6681 阅读 · 7 评论